Baking cakes
The oven should always be warm before putting in cakes
wait till the end of preheating (about 10-15 min.). Cake-
baking temperatures are normally around 160°C/200°C.
Do not open the oven door during the baking process as
this could cause the cake to sink.In general:
Pastry is too dry
Increase the temperature by 10°C and reduce the
cooking time.

Timer Feature
The timer operates by counting down a given period of
time. This feature does not, however, turn the oven on or
off. It merely emits an acoustical alarm when the time has
run out.
How to Set the Timer
Turn the knob until the indicator is set on the length of
time desired (using the inside numbers). The time is clearly
visible through the transparent window on the indicator
itself.
The timer will begin to count down immediately.
The sound will stop automatically after approximately 2
minutes and the timer will be set to the symbol (clock
function).
To turn off the buzzer, or to use only the clock, set the
indicator on the symbol.
How to Set the Current Time
The oven must be connected to the power supply.
Pull and turn the knob in the clockwise direction to set
the time.

Storage recess below the oven (only a few models)
Below the oven a recess can be used to contain cooking pans
and cooker accessories. Moreover, during oven operation, it may
be used to keep food warm.To open the storage is necessary
turn it downwards.
Caution: this storage recess must not be used to store
inflammable materials.
Practical advice for burner use
In order to get the maximum yield it is important to remember
the following:
· Use appropriate cookware for each burner (see table) so as
to avoid flames overshooting the edges.
· At boiling point turn the knob to minimum.
· Use cookware with lids.
· Always use cookware with flat bottoms.
Burner ø Cookware diameter (cm)
Fast (R) 24 - 26
Semi Fast (S) 16 - 20
Auxiliary (A) 10 - 14
